My major instrument in college was clarinet, but I am a woodwind specialist, having performance experience on flute, clarinet, and saxophone. I have a particular affinity for late beginners, and have had some success in helping these students catch up to their peers. All of my woodwind students use the Rubank method books in addition to any method books they may already be using in their band classes. I also introduce appropriate literature and studies specific to each instrument once the basics have been mastered. I encourage all of my woodwind students to participate in OMEA Solo and Ensemble contest and to audition for OMEA District and State Honor Bands.
